Seems a bit weird to be entered in a competition to win a bass amp and not know what you're winning. Usually IME the competition prize is basically an advert for the product and there's loads of promo and info on where to buy one and why it's so good.

 

 

Markbass is a sponsor of the Ernie Ball Battle of the Bands, which travels alongside the Warped Tour and the Taste of Chaos tour.

The four winning bands from the Warped Tour segment won a bunch of gear, including a Markbass R500 and CL106.

The OP is the bassist for one of these bands.

Markbass gear can be ordered in to any Guitar Center, or straight to your door. There's also a 60-day no-questions-asked return policy if you're not happy.

Since there's 215 Guitar Centers across the US, that's better coverage/availability than most bass amp brands!
